Spanish
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ˈtɾom.pa/
Etymology 1
From Frankish *trumpa.
Noun
trompa f (plural trompas)
- snout (long, projecting nose, mouth and jaw of a beast)
- trunk (of an elephant)
- (music) horn
- proboscis
- (anatomy) tube (especially the Fallopian tube)
- trompa de Falopio
- Fallopian tube
- trompa de Falopio
- booze-up; drinking sesh
